Product description The NSI/Leviton PARML-0SB Multi Lens PAR Fixture is a low cost, versatile lighting fixture designed for diverse applications. The die-cast aluminum housing which accepts either 575 or 750W lamps comes with a set of four lenses that range from very narrow spot to wide flood. The PARML-0SB features tool-free lamp changing and thermally insulated knobs and comes with a gel frame for effects filters and a Stage Pin plug. - Rugged, die-cast aluminum construction
- Tool-free access to reflector, lens, and lamp replacement
- Thermally insulated knobs
- Insulated lens rotating ring
- 36" high temperature lead
- Four lenses provided:
- Very Narrow Spot (round beam)
- Narrow Spot (round beam)
- Medium Flood (oval beam)
- Wide Flood (oval beam)
- The removable, two-slot accessory holder has a self-closing, self-locking latch for safety
- Parabolic reflector made of high-grade aluminum, polished to a mirror finish
- Positive locking action on yoke
- G9.5 medium two-pin lamp holder accepts a wide variety of non-proprietary lamps
- Lower wattage lamps drastically reducing power consumption while simultaneously increasing dimmer capacity
- Accepts standard 10" accessories
In the Box NSI / Leviton Multi Lens PAR Fixture (Black) C-Clamp Color Frame VNSP Lens NSP Lens MFL Lens WFL Lens Limited 1-Year Warranty Table of Contents

Technical parametersNSI / Leviton Multi-Lens PAR Specs | Rating | 700 W maximum | | Socket (Lampholder) | G9.5 medium two-pin lamp holder | | Lens (Condenser) | Includes interchangeable: Very Narrow Spot (round beam) Narrow Spot (round beam) Medium Flood (oval beam) Wide Flood (oval beam) | | Reflector (Mirror) | Parabolic | | Mounting | C-clamp | | Yoke | Flat-bladed fork | | Cable | 36" / 0.91 m high-temperature lead with 15 A 5-15 PBG plug | | Focusing | No |
